    Interpolation for nonlinear BVP in circular membrane with known upper and lower solutions

    AbstractA successive nonextrapolatory linear interpolation is described to solve a singular two-point boundary value problem arising in circular membrane theory. The problem is associated with a second-order nonlinear ordinary differential equation for which the upper and lower bounds of the solution is analytically established/known. The importance and the scope of these bounds in solving the problem is stressed. Also depicted graphically are the lower and upper solutions as well as the true and iterated solutions. In addition, discussed are the reasons why linear interpolation, and not nonlinear interpolation or bisection which are possible procedures, has been employed

    Fabrication of Low-Roughness Au/Ti/ SiO2/Si Substrates for Nanopatterning of 16-Mercapto Hexadecanoic Acid (MHA) by Dip-Pen-Nanolithography

    Silicon based low-roughness Au/Ti/SiO2/Si substrates were fabricated using standard IC fabrication processes. Evolution of surface roughness during substrate fabrication process was studied. Fabrication process steps, namely, thermal oxidation and e-beam evaporation for ultra-thin Ti(~ 5 nm)/Au(22 nm) films, were optimized to result in surface r.m.s roughness ~ 0.2 m and ~ 1.0 nm, after thermal oxidation and Ti/Au deposition steps respectively. Surface roughness was estimated by atomic force microscope (AFM) imaging and image analysis. Nano-patterning experiments using thiol based 16-MHA molecular-ink on fabricated substrates were carried out, under controlled environment conditions, by dip-pen-nanolithography (DPN) technique.     Obstructive Granulomatous Bronchiolitis Obliterans due to Mycobacterium tuberculosis

    Bronchiolitis obliterans is an uncommon cause of obstructive airway disease in adults characterised by progressive irreversible airway obstruction. Granulomatous bronchiolitis is a rare entity and tuberculosis presenting as bronchiolitis is distinctly uncommon. The authors present a case of tubercular granulomatous bronchiolitis obliterans, confirmed on histopathology, who responded completely to anti-tubercular chemotherapy

    Determination of Copper, Total Chromium and Silver in Impregnated Carbon

    Carbon samples were impregnated with ammonical solutions of silver salt alone and in combination with Cu and Cr salts. The impregnated samples were characterised for Cu, total Cr and Ag. Copper was extracted as CuCl/sub 2/ using concentrated HCl and Cr with NaOH. Silver was extracted from impregnated carbon using HNO3 and sodium thiosulphate (Na/sub 2/S/sub 2/O/sub 3/-5H/sub 2/0) and ashed impregnated carbons using aqua regia. The extracted metals in their solutions were quantitatively determined by titrimetric method and atomic absorption spectroscopy. The results were within acceptable limits of error. Sodium thiosulphate is recommended for extraction of Ag, as it accomplishes complete leaching of Ag faster than the other extracting agents
